Description:
I use "Set Page Variable" in the header of the first page of each chapter in my
books, and "Show Page Variable" in the headers of subsequent pages, in order to
display the page number within the chapter. Each "chapter" is an .odt file
imported into a .odm master document. (The absolute page number within the book
is displayed in the footer.) This has worked fine in all versions before
version 7.x, but it does not work in 7.x -- "Show Page Variable" shows nothing.

Steps to Reproduce:
See description and attached example.

Actual Results:
Header shows: "1-" on all pages of chapter.

Expected Results:
Header should show: "1-1" on first page of chapter, and "1-2" on second page,
etc.
